Chelsea news: Bournemouth to Block January Move for Milos Kerkez but Summer Exit Remains Likely

Chelsea news: Bournemouth are set to firmly reject any January approach for star left-back Milos Kerkez. Despite rising interest from Premier League giants Chelsea and Liverpool, the Cherries have no intention of parting ways with the 21-year-old defender during the winter transfer window. However, a summer transfer could remain a possibility depending on future circumstances.

Kerkez’s impressive performances this season have caught the attention of top clubs, making him one of the most sought-after young defenders in the league. Since joining Bournemouth, the Hungarian international has played a pivotal role in the team’s remarkable rise to eighth in the Premier League table. Under the guidance of manager Andoni Iraola, Bournemouth have transformed into a formidable side aiming for higher ambitions, including a potential European qualification spot.

Given their impressive form, Bournemouth are determined to hold onto key players like Kerkez to maintain their momentum. With the team performing beyond expectations, the club recognizes the importance of stability and continuity. For that reason, they will block any January offers, regardless of the figures on the table. Kerkez, who was previously valued at around £40 million, is now firmly off the market as far as the winter window is concerned.

What’s the matter?

The club’s decision will undoubtedly disappoint Chelsea and Liverpool, both of whom have expressed strong interest in signing the Hungarian. Liverpool, in particular, have been actively scouting options to address their long-term concerns at left-back. With Andy Robertson facing recurring injury problems and Kostas Tsimikas lacking consistency, Liverpool see Kerkez as a perfect candidate to solidify the position for years to come.

Meanwhile, Chelsea are also closely monitoring Kerkez’s situation. The Blues are actively recruiting young, talented players to bolster their squad under their new project. With Marc Cucurella struggling to justify his hefty price tag, Chelsea believe Kerkez could provide competition and balance to their left flank. From both clubs’ perspectives, Kerkez represents a prime transfer target, given his age, skillset, and potential for further development.

For now, however, Bournemouth remain resolute in their decision. The Cherries have lofty ambitions this season, and selling their key defender midway through the campaign could derail their plans. Retaining Kerkez will ensure that Iraola’s squad remains competitive and well-equipped to challenge for a place in Europe.

While Bournemouth’s stance on Kerkez is clear for January, the summer window could tell a different story. Should the 21-year-old maintain his exceptional form, it will be increasingly difficult for Bournemouth to fend off offers from bigger clubs. Kerkez’s value will likely continue to rise, and suitors such as Liverpool and Chelsea will return with even greater determination.

Both clubs are preparing for the possibility of a summer bidding war. Liverpool’s new manager, Arne Slot, reportedly views Kerkez as a long-term solution to their left-back issues, while Chelsea are eager to add depth and competition to their defensive lineup. From Kerkez’s perspective, a move to either club would mark a significant step forward in his career, allowing him to compete at the highest level in both domestic and European competitions.
